I just listened to Jason Alba, CEO of Jibber Jobber talk today in Austin, a presentation organized by Right Management.  Jason is an expert on Linked-In and author of I’m On Linked-In, Now What? Jason is remarkably funny.  He said when he was a job seeker, he felt like a leper.  He had great tips for networking and books such as Never Eat Alone and BRAG! The Art of Tooting Your Horn Without Blowing It.

Quick story: Jason lost his job and discovered how morally and mentally challenging the job search can be.   Out of the insights he gained–PAIN he experienced– started Jibber Jobber, which is  a Customer Relationship Management tool for the job seeker.  There is a free version and a full version for subscribers.  The tool looks awesome.  Jason also gave us some great tips on Linked-In, such as the Ask Questions feature.  And how to link to your resumes through posting on a site such as emurse.com.
